Gets washed about once a month and I use S100 cycle cleaner. You just spray it on and rinse it off with water. Then I use distilled water that i collect from the dehumidifier to wash the hose water off of the bike. Using distilled water to do the final rinse leaves no spots. Takes about 15 min total

yup, takes about 3 gal to rinse off the bike. Works like a charm. My dehumidifier drains into a 50 gallon plastic tank, drop in a submersable pump into the tank with a hose on the end and your on your way to a spot free wash. Or your can just buy distilled water by the gallon from the grocery store.
